Square creates tools that help sellers of all sizes start, run, and grow their businesses. Square's point-of-sale service offers tools for every part of running a business, from accepting credit cards and tracking inventory, to real-time analytics and invoicing. Square also offers sellers financial and marketing services, including small business financing and customer engagement tools. Square was founded in 2009 and is headquartered in San Francisco, with offices in the United States, Canada, Japan, and Australia.

Problems we work on

  • Underwriting: What qualifies a creditworthy merchant? How do their products and services add value for customers? We place smart bets on great merchants to grow our business and ensure a beautiful payment experience for our merchants and their customers.

  • Fraud: We make quick decisions on millions of dollars. This requires sound judgement, thorough diligence, and passion for detecting bad actors and preventing loss.

  • Machine Learning: We build and refine powerful machine learning models to identify good and bad ‘actors’. These models automate decisions, prioritise our work, and change the behavior of Square’s products in real time.

  • Tools: We work with our engineers to build and refine fantastic tools to gain leverage and scale super-linearly with our rapid growth in volume.
